My Buying Guides on Gate Thumb Latch Hardware
What I Look for First
When I shop for gate thumb latch hardware, I start with the basics: the gate type, the material, and the level of security I need. I always make sure the latch matches my gate’s thickness and swing direction, because even a strong latch can be frustrating if it doesn’t fit properly.
Material and Durability
In my experience, the material matters a lot. I usually prefer heavy-duty metal like steel, wrought iron, or stainless steel because they hold up better outdoors. If I want something that resists rust, I look for powder-coated or galvanized finishes. For decorative gates, I also check whether the hardware has a protective coating so it keeps its appearance over time.
Ease of Installation
I like hardware that comes with clear instructions and all the mounting pieces I need. Some thumb latches are simple to install with basic tools, while others may need more precise alignment. I always read the product details to see if it is suitable for wood, vinyl, or metal gates before I buy.
Security and Functionality
For me, a good thumb latch should be easy to open from one side but secure enough to keep the gate closed. If I need extra privacy or safety, I look for models that include a locking feature or can be paired with a padlock. I also test whether the latch feels smooth and reliable, since a stiff mechanism can become annoying fast.
Style and Design
I often choose gate thumb latch hardware that matches the overall look of my fence or gate. Some designs are more rustic, while others are sleek and modern. I like decorative black iron finishes for a classic look, but I also consider simple styles when I want the latch to blend in.
Weather Resistance
Because gate hardware is exposed to the elements, I always check how well it handles rain, sun, and temperature changes. I’ve found that weather-resistant finishes can make a big difference in how long the latch lasts. If the gate is in a coastal or humid area, I pay extra attention to corrosion resistance.
Price vs. Value
I don’t always go for the cheapest option, because low-cost hardware sometimes wears out quickly. Instead, I compare the build quality, finish, and included accessories to see if the price makes sense. In my experience, paying a little more for better durability usually saves money later.
